Output 51d1fc001c145d0ab26ee86d7903f397bd43e5b086102e148deac6d556c0ca81:1

value
89000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b152bb9d1ed3fec267eded156ffe2a11155d08d OP_EQUALVERIFY OP_CHECKSIG
address
16PQEHtnC12q2xWDNLKDQBYHUcpkuNakxk
transaction
51d1fc001c145d0ab26ee86d7903f397bd43e5b086102e148deac6d556c0ca81
spent
true